Good alternative to Newsify and Reeder but with need for some minor fixes: 1. Reading and article doesn’t mark it as read and there is no gesture to mark all as read (eg, swiping down) 2. Background sync is random; many times it doesn’t happen for a long interval and it’s as if the app updates when it decides to. The Android version can specify the sync interval so why can’t the iOS version? 3. Embedded tweets don’t display in the web view I’ve reached out to the developer multiple times and have never heard back. The main advantage of this over Newsify (which has some advantages) is the seemingly built-in content blocker support that fixes some problematic ads on various sites.
